The Klosterschule Roßleben is an over-denominational boarding gymnasium for girls and boys, recognized as one of the oldest boarding schools in Germany. It combines a nearly 500-year-old tradition of critical thinking with innovative pedagogy to prepare students for their future lives and careers.

Teaching approach

The school is guided by Christian and humanistic-ethical principles, aiming to provide education regardless of a student's social background. Its core values are summarized by the Latin terms Prudentia (prudence), Diligentia (diligence), Constantia (constancy), and Modestia (modesty). The educational approach emphasizes a community based on trust, openness, and social diversity, while maintaining high academic standards and fostering individual personality development.

Programmes

The school operates as a gymnasium, offering a comprehensive academic curriculum leading to the Abitur. It provides bilingual teaching modules and the opportunity to earn the Cambridge Certificate in English. The academic programme is supported by a digital school infrastructure and includes specialized guidance for university and career preparation. Internationalism is a key focus, supported by membership in the Round Square network, which facilitates global projects and student exchanges.

Learning support

The school provides individualized support to help students overcome academic deficits and address personal challenges. Tutors serve as primary caregivers and points of contact for both students and parents, ensuring close monitoring of academic progress. During the 'Silentium' period, students receive consistent support and supervision for homework and exam preparation. Additionally, older students act as mentors and tutors for younger peers to facilitate conflict resolution and academic assistance.

Admissions

The school conducts personal interviews with parents and students prior to admission to assess individual talents and identify potential support needs. Prospective students are invited to participate in trial days to experience classroom and boarding life. The admissions process varies by grade level, with upper school coordinators assisting with course selection and younger students receiving guidance on language and elective choices. Financial aid is available through various scholarships for students with strong academic performance and extracurricular engagement, as well as support for families in need.

Calendar

The school year includes regular academic terms punctuated by special events such as the opening church service, seasonal camps (winter, summer, autumn, and Christmas), and festive dinners. The calendar features mandatory boarding weekends for specific activities, alongside periods where students may return home. Regular school life is structured around daily routines, including morning prayer services, academic lessons, and evening study sessions.

About the campus

The campus spans an eight-hectare park and features historic buildings, including a baroque school building and the 'Aqua' residence for older students. Sports facilities include a synthetic turf pitch, rugby field, tennis courts, and basketball courts. The school also maintains a greenhouse for student use, a dedicated music academy, and a school church with a historic organ. Boarding students are accommodated in single or double rooms, with communal areas in each wing equipped with sofas and televisions.

Co-curriculars

The school offers a wide range of 'Gilden' (clubs) categorized into sports, social, environmental, and creative activities. Sports options include basketball, hockey, volleyball, rugby, football, tennis, athletics, yoga, and rowing, while creative pursuits range from robotics, theatre, and media studies to woodwork and baking. Students also engage in social projects, such as volunteering with the fire service, supporting local elderly homes, or participating in charity initiatives like HerzCasper. Musical opportunities are provided through the Music Academy, which offers individual instrumental lessons, choir, and band participation.
